Fire stopping specialist FSi Promat has launched Stopseal® Linear Joint Seal (LJS), a dry-fit, fast to install, fire resistant product which provides a high-performance volume expansion and pressure seal

Stopseal® LJS is designed to reinstate the fire resistance of wall and floor constructions in linear gaps, and is tested to EN1366-4 : 2021 (Fire resistance tests for service installations – Part 4: Linear joint seals) Stopseal® LJS has replaced Stopseal® Linear Gap Seal (LGS), which was discontinued in August of last year.

Available in one metre strips and in five thicknesses, Stopseal® LJS can be used to protect joint widths from 10mm to 100mm, and all sizes of Stopseal® LJS have been fire tested in both floor and wall orientations.

Fire testing

As part of the series of fire tests, product manufacture at FSi Promat’s UK factory was witnessed by representatives from UL, and samples sent to UKAS accredited labs for fire testing. This rigorous third-party oversight provides confidence when specifying Stopseal® LJS that the product will perform as designed in the event of a fire. In both walls and floors Stopseal® LJSprovides up to E240 and EI120.

Stopseal® LJS is a dry fit solution made up of layers of intumescent material and acoustic foam. During fitting the strips are compressed to fit into the joint gap and will then expand to protect and insulate space left between walls and floors to contain the spread of fire for a set period of time.
